How Reforestation Helps to Improve Water Quality
The impact of reforestation on water quality cannot be overstated. When you think about how pollutants enter waterways, it becomes evident that trees act as natural filters. Their leaves and branches intercept rainfall, allowing water to drip slowly to the ground rather than rushing off into streams and rivers.
This slow release helps to reduce sedimentation and erosion, which are common culprits in water pollution. By participating in reforestation projects, you are directly contributing to the improvement of water quality in your local environment. Additionally, trees absorb harmful substances from the soil and air, further enhancing water quality.
For instance, they can take up excess nutrients like nitrogen and phosphorus that often lead to algal blooms in aquatic systems. When you support reforestation initiatives, you are not only helping to restore habitats but also promoting healthier waterways. The presence of trees can significantly reduce the levels of contaminants in nearby rivers and lakes, making them safer for both human use and wildlife.

Reforestation as a Method to Prevent Soil Erosion and Flooding
Soil erosion and flooding are two significant challenges that many regions face today, often exacerbated by deforestation and land degradation. When you participate in reforestation efforts, you are actively combating these issues by restoring vegetation cover that stabilizes soil. The roots of trees bind the soil together, reducing the likelihood of erosion caused by wind and water.
This stabilization is particularly crucial in hilly or mountainous areas where heavy rains can lead to devastating landslides. In addition to preventing soil erosion, reforestation also plays a vital role in flood mitigation. Trees act as natural sponges, absorbing excess rainfall and releasing it slowly over time.
This process helps to reduce peak flow rates during storms, minimizing the risk of flooding downstream. By engaging in reforestation projects, you contribute to creating landscapes that are more resilient to extreme weather events, ultimately protecting communities from the adverse effects of flooding.

Case Studies of Successful Reforestation Projects and Their Impact on Water Conservation

Examining successful reforestation projects around the world provides valuable insights into how these initiatives can effectively enhance water conservation efforts. One notable example is the reforestation project in Ethiopia known as the Green Legacy Initiative. Launched in 2019, this ambitious program aims to plant billions of trees across the country to combat deforestation and restore degraded landscapes.
As a result of these efforts, local communities have reported improved access to clean water sources due to enhanced groundwater recharge and reduced soil erosion. Another inspiring case is found in Costa Rica, where reforestation initiatives have transformed landscapes while improving water quality. The country implemented a Payment for Ecosystem Services program that incentivizes landowners to restore forest cover on their properties.
This approach has led to significant increases in forested areas, resulting in cleaner rivers and improved water supply for surrounding communities. By studying these successful projects, you can see how reforestation not only benefits ecosystems but also enhances human well-being through improved access to vital resources.

What is reforestation?
Reforestation is the process of planting trees in areas where forests have been depleted or destroyed. It is done to restore the ecological balance, improve air quality, and prevent soil erosion.
How does reforestation help with water conservation?
Reforestation helps with water conservation in several ways. Trees help to absorb and retain water in the soil, reducing runoff and erosion. They also help to regulate the water cycle, increasing groundwater recharge and maintaining stream flow.
What are the benefits of reforestation for water conservation?
Reforestation can help to improve water quality, reduce the risk of flooding, and provide a sustainable source of water for both human and natural ecosystems. It also helps to mitigate the impacts of climate change on water resources.
What are some examples of successful reforestation projects for water conservation?
There are many successful reforestation projects around the world that have contributed to water conservation. For example, the “Green Belt Movement” in Kenya has planted over 51 million trees to combat deforestation and improve water resources.
